ABOUT US

How it all began and looking forward.

During the 1960's Dr Gunther A Scherr formulated, manufactured and used a special type of high-flexible asphalt emulsion in the construction of surface coatings, particularly on such roads that could not be constructed in the standard method. This was just a surface coating and did not give satisfactory results.

On further investigation it became evident that the existing Ground Stabilisations offered worldwide at the time could not solve the problems associated with cohesive in-situ soils. There was no product on the market which achieved satisfactory results. It was at that point in the late 1960's that Dr Scherr decided to develop his own range of products. After extensive laboratory research & development, site experiments showed remarkable field results.

The first field application was put down in 1968 in Italy. In 1973 Quantum GS was founded in Switzerland for ongoing research, development work and worldwide marketing.
